Professional Accounting Certificate
Graduates of the Professional Accounting Certificate program will be able to integrate accounting with general business and information technology tools to maximize their contribution to the success of any organization.
Students will learn:
- Introductory and Intermediate Financial Accounting
- Management Accounting
- Finance
- Economics
- Law
- Statistical Analysis
- Communications (Oral and Written)
- Information Systems
The Professional Accounting Certificate fulfills 7 of 12 prerequisites for entry to the CPA Professional Education Program (CPA PEP). The remaining 5 prerequisites can be completed through the Advanced Accounting Certificate.
